Volunteers Carry 102-Pound Dog Down Mountain
A large dog got exhausted during a hike, volunteers rescued her.

A 102-pound dog became exhausted during a challenging hike in Pennsylvania. The dog's owner had to leave her briefly to seek assistance from emergency services.
The owner's decision to seek help proved to be the right one, as the dog was unable to climb down the mountain on her own. Volunteers from the Waterville Fire Company quickly organized a rescue operation to help the tired dog.
The volunteers used a special stretcher to carefully transport the dog down the mountain. The rescue operation was a long and challenging one, taking around 4 hours to complete.
